#1a2857 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a2857 is composed of 10.2% red, 15.7%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.1% cyan, 54%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 226.2 degrees, a saturation of 54% and a lightness of 22.2%. #1a2857 color hex could be obtained by blending #3450ae with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#1a2857 color description : Very dark blue.
#1a2857 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a2857 has RGB values of R:26, G:40,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 1714263.

Shades and Tints of #1a2857
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03050b is the darkest color, while #fbf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a2857
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#383839 is the less saturated color, while #041c6d is the most saturated one.
